Agrana Names Franz Ennser as New COO and Board Member
Agrana has appointed Franz Ennser as its new Chief Operating Officer (COO) and board member, effective November 1, 2025. The supervisory board made this decision, adding Ennser to the existing board comprising chairman Stephan Büttner, Norbert Harringer, and Stephan Meeder.
Ennser brings extensive experience to his new role, having served as CEO of Austria Juice GmbH since 2014. He has been with the Agrana Group since 1998 and led Austria Juice since 2006. As COO, Ennser will oversee agricultural raw materials, operational excellence, and procurement/logistics/supply chain. He will also continue to lead Austria Juice GmbH. Ennser's appointment is for a period of three years.
